4 Derby Lane, DE6 2EY
4 Derby Lane is a freehold semi-detached house on Derby Lane in DE6. It last sold for £180,000 in 2020, its only sale in HM Land Registry's records.

4 Derby Lane: quick answers
From HM Land Registry, EPC, VOA, Police.uk, DfE and Environment Agency records.
4 Derby Lane last sold for £180,000 on 3 Apr 2020, according to HM Land Registry.
HM Land Registry records 1 sale for 4 Derby Lane. Sales before 1995 are not in the public dataset.
Its most recent Energy Performance Certificate records 78 m² of floor area.
4 Derby Lane is in council tax band C, costing about £2,173 a year (Derbyshire Dales).
Its most recent EPC rates it B (score 82).
Carrying its 2020 sale price forward with DE6's market movement suggests roughly £207,000–£269,000 as of 2026. This is indicative only — the full report values it against individual comparable sales.
